centos7上关闭telnet服务的命令
在CentOS 7上关闭Telnet服务有多种方法,可以通过禁用服务、删除相关软件包或禁止相关系统服务来实现。以下是针对不同情况的具体步骤。
方法一:禁用Telnet服务
1.登录到CentOS 7服务器,使用root用户或具有sudo权限的用户。centos7没有vim命令
2.执行以下命令以停止Telnet服务:
```shell
systemctl stop telnet.socket
systemctl stop telnet@.service
```
3.执行以下命令以禁用Telnet服务:
```shell
systemctl disable telnet.socket
systemctl disable telnet@.service
```
4.验证是否成功禁用了Telnet服务:
```shell
systemctl status telnet.socket
systemctl status telnet@.service
```
如果服务状态显示为"disabled",则表示禁用成功。
方法二:删除Telnet软件包
1.登录到CentOS 7服务器,使用root用户或具有sudo权限的用户。
2.执行以下命令以删除Telnet软件包:
```shell
yum remove telnet-server telnet
```
3.完成后,Telnet服务将被彻底移除。
4.验证是否成功删除了Telnet软件包:
```shell
rpm -qa | grep telnet
```
如果没有任何输出,则表示删除成功。
方法三:禁止相关系统服务
1.登录到CentOS 7服务器,使用root用户或具有sudo权限的用户。
2.执行以下命令以编辑Telnet服务配置文件:
```shell
vi /etc/xinetd.d/telnet
```
如果不到该文件,则可能是没有安装xinetd软件包,请先用以下命令安装:
```shell
yum install -y xinetd
```
3.在配置文件中到以下行并注释掉(在行前加上“#”符号):
```
disable = no
```
4.保存并关闭文件。
5.执行以下命令以重启xinetd服务:
```shell
systemctl restart xinetd
```
6.验证是否成功禁止了Telnet服务:
```shell
netstat -tuln | grep 23
```
如果没有任何输出,则表示禁用成功。
无论使用哪种方法,禁用Telnet服务都是为了增强安全性。由于Telnet是明文传输,存在被窃听和中间人攻击的风险,因此推荐使用更安全的SSH(Secure Shell)来进行远程访问和管理。SSH使用加密算法保护数据传输,提供更高的安全性。
注意:在禁用或删除Telnet服务之前,请确保没有重要的应用程序或依赖于Telnet的服务在使用。如果有,请在操作之前备份相关配置,并确保备份可用以及能够恢复。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。